Output e61eb7367ce5f56e37addf0f41d04f50531aba9c141f9cc558abd5cbdecd0a1a:12

value
2398317259
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c8712e79475f1a0e73e310885774871551792b1 OP_EQUAL
address
37D4H9bHby8YHkBGFBUhBzfBrYdDw8wzTt
transaction
e61eb7367ce5f56e37addf0f41d04f50531aba9c141f9cc558abd5cbdecd0a1a
confirmations
375947
spent
true